In a triangle `ABC, CD` is the bisector of the angle C. If `cos (C/2)` has the value `1/3 and l(CD)=6,` then `(1/a+1/b)` has the value equal to -

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
`(1)/(9)`

`Delta = Delta_(1) + Delta_(2)`
or `(1)/(2) ab sin C = (1)/(2) 6b sin.(C)/(2) + (1)/(2)6a sin.(C)/(2)`
or `ab sin.(C)/(2) cos.(C)/(2) = (1)/(2) 6b sin.(C)/(2) + (1)/(2) 6a sin.(C)/(2)`
or `(1)/(a) + (1)/(b) = (1)/(9)`
